Transaction 59da8a0c26d7e4a793a5a21ced4580c32d5a608b9c44cf07a5da2bac6464ca4b

1 Input
2 Outputs
  • 59da8a0c26d7e4a793a5a21ced4580c32d5a608b9c44cf07a5da2bac6464ca4b:0
  • value  97393446
    address  1J7ddEqoviakfxrn9gUyELVtPiHniSuPpo
  • 59da8a0c26d7e4a793a5a21ced4580c32d5a608b9c44cf07a5da2bac6464ca4b:1
  • value  2490634
    address  1DSQKjFhKm2j144BNUGBLYZr1e6NqBnfHr